Что такое блокчейн: основное определение и ключевые особенности
Блокчейн составляет собой распространённую систему данных, которая содержит данные в форме последовательности объединённых блоков. Каждый блок хранит данные о транзакциях, временны́е штампы и криптографические отсылки на предыдущий звено последовательности. Технология предоставляет прозрачность и постоянство данных благодаря распределённой структуре.
Ключевая особенность системы заключается в отсутствии центрального учреждения управления. Дубликаты регистра содержатся параллельно на множестве устройств по всему миру. Участники системы контролируют и подтверждают свежие данные сообща, что исключает подделку информации.
Криптографические методы охраняют неприкосновенность информации в покердом казино. Каждый блок включает неповторимый цифровой след, который создаётся на основе наполнения и связи с предшествующими звеньями. Корректировка сведений потребует перерасчета всех последующих элементов, что практически неосуществимо при достаточном числе участников.
Ясность операций даёт возможность отслеживать хронологию операций. Технология обеспечивает конфиденциальность через структуру открытых и закрытых шифров. Сочетание публичности и анонимности создаёт пространство для обмена ценностями без посредников.
Как устроен элемент: организация информации, заголовок, хэш и соединения между звеньями
Блок складывается из двух главных компонентов: заголовка и тела с сведениями. Заголовок содержит метаданные для идентификации и связывания элементов цепочки. Корпус элемента охватывает список операций или других записей, которые механизм фиксирует в заданный миг.
Заголовок элемента включает несколько критически важных атрибутов. Временна́я отметка фиксирует момент создания элемента. Номер редакции определяет требования алгоритма. Параметр сложности задаёт условия к расчётной процессу для присоединения нового блока.
Хэш составляет собой уникальный электронный код блока, сформированный посредством криптографическую операцию. Алгоритм трансформирует все сведения в последовательность неизменной длины. Малейшее корректировка содержимого ведёт к полному изменению хэша, что делает подделку сведений явной для пользователей покердом.
Соединение между элементами реализуется через специальное параметр в заголовке, которое хранит хэш предыдущего блока. Каждый следующий блок отсылает на предшественника, формируя непрерывную цепь от генезис-блока до текущего периода. Нарушение любого элемента делает ошибочными все следующие элементы, что охраняет сохранность архитектуры сведений.
Концепция цепочки элементов
Цепочка блоков формируется способом постепенного добавления свежих элементов к действующей архитектуре. Каждый элемент включает криптографическую ссылку на предыдущий, образуя сплошную серию записей. Первый элемент называется генезис-блоком и выступает отправной позицией структуры.
Принцип связывания гарантирует охрану от неавторизованных изменений. Хэш прошлого блока включается в заголовок последующего, формируя математическую связь. Попытка модификации информации требует перерасчёта всех следующих блоков, что предполагает колоссальных вычислительных мощностей.
Последовательная система растёт только в одном направлении. Следующие элементы добавляются в окончание цепочки после валидации. Члены контролируют точность отсылок и соответствие требованиям алгоритма перед добавлением нового элемента в pokerdom.
Временна́я серия сведений позволяет отслеживать историю событий. Каждый блок запечатлевает конкретное момент генерации, что превращает осуществимым воссоздание летописи операций. Распределённое хранение множества экземпляров цепочки гарантирует наличие информации при отключении фрагмента серверов. Единообразие информации поддерживается через стандарты синхронизации и валидации.
Члены сети: серверы, майнеры и валидаторы в распределённой системе
Распределённая система связывает разнообразные категории участников, каждый из которых выполняет особые роли. Узлы хранят дубликаты реестра и предоставляют доступность информации. Майнеры создают следующие блоки через выполнение вычислительных задач. Валидаторы верифицируют корректность переводов и утверждают законность.
Узлы классифицируются на несколько типов по объёму функций:
- Полноценные узлы сохраняют всю хронологию последовательности и проверяют все переводы согласно требованиям стандарта
- Облегчённые узлы включают только заголовки элементов и требуют добавочную сведения при необходимости
- Архивные узлы сохраняют все промежуточные стадии системы для подробного изучения хронологии
Майнеры соревнуются за право добавить новый элемент в цепочку. Специализированное оборудование производит миллионы расчётов в секунду для нахождения верного хэша. Первый член, выполнивший проблему, обретает премию и комиссии с транзакций в покердом казино.
Валидаторы работают в системах с иными протоколами консенсуса. Пользователи замораживают конкретное количество токенов как обеспечение честного действия. Возможность валидировать операции разделяется между валидаторами на базе объёма залога и характеристик стандарта.
Алгоритмы консенсуса: Proof of Work, Proof of Stake и иные методы
Алгоритмы согласия определяют правила получения согласия между участниками распространённой структуры. Механизмы гарантируют согласованное состояние журнала на всех серверах без единого управляющего. Разнообразные методы используют отличающиеся приёмы выбора членов для создания элементов.
Proof of Work основан на выполнении непростых вычислительных проблем. Майнеры просматривают миллиарды вариантов для нахождения хеша с определёнными параметрами. Механизм требует немалых расходов электроэнергии и вычислительных ресурсов. Трудность проблемы регулируется для поддержания стабильного времени создания элементов в покердом.
Proof of Stake выбирает создателей элементов на основании количества зарезервированных токенов. Члены вносят депозит как гарантию добросовестного поведения. Шанс создать блок соответствует размеру залога. Протокол потребляет намного меньше электричества по сопоставлению с вычислительными способами.
Делегированный Proof of Stake даёт возможность владельцам токенов голосовать за ограниченное число валидаторов. Избранные участники поочерёдно формируют элементы и обретают награду. Практический Byzantine Fault Tolerance применяется в частных сетях с известным реестром участников.
Как проходят переводы в блокчейне
Перевод начинается с генерации запроса клиентом посредством программный интерфейс. Отправитель формирует сообщение с указанием адресата, суммы и дополнительных настроек. Закрытый шифр владельца подписывает транзакцию криптографически, подтверждая полномочие управлять активами.
Подписанная транзакция направляется в очередь ожидания с необработанными заявками. Серверы структуры контролируют точность подписи и достаточность баланса отправителя. Правильные переводы распространяются между членами через механизмы передачи данными. Недействительные заявки отвергаются.
Майнеры или валидаторы отбирают операции из пула для включения в свежий элемент. Первенство обретают транзакции с более большими комиссиями. Создатель блока объединяет выбранные переводы и добавляет их в организацию сведений с метаинформацией в pokerdom.
После добавления блока в цепь перевод обретает первое подтверждение. Каждый дальнейший блок повышает число подтверждений и понижает возможность аннулирования операции. Большинство систем признают транзакцию финальной после определённого количества подтверждений. Получатель может применять полученные ресурсы после получения нужного степени защищённости.
Репликация и содержание данных: как распространённая структура сохраняет единую версию регистра
Копирование обеспечивает содержание идентичных экземпляров регистра на множестве независимых узлов. Каждый полный сервер включает полную историю переводов с времени старта структуры. Распределённое содержание исключает единую позицию отказа и обеспечивает доступность данных при отказе из строя некоторых узлов.
Согласование информации происходит посредством постоянный передачу данными между узлами. Свежие блоки передаются по структуре через протоколы передачи сообщений. Пользователи контролируют принятые сведения на соблюдение нормам и добавляют корректные блоки в местную копию цепи в покердом казино.
Противоречия возникают, когда несколько майнеров синхронно генерируют элементы на идентичной позиции. Система временно хранит несколько версий последовательности, пока не выявится самая длинная ветвь. Узлы автоматически переходят на цепь с наибольшим количеством накопленной мощности.
Алгоритмы валидации дают возможность новым серверам верифицировать точность летописи при первом присоединении. Пользователь загружает элементы последовательно и контролирует криптографические связи между компонентами. Упрощённые серверы используют облегчённую верификацию посредством заголовки элементов для сбережения мощностей.
Плюсы и недостатки блокчейна и распределённых систем
Децентрализация исключает необходимость доверять единому управляющему или организации. Участники структуры совместно контролируют структуру и выносят решения согласно нормам протокола. Отсутствие единого органа уменьшает опасности цензуры и искажений данными.
Ясность действий позволяет любому члену верифицировать хронологию операций и убедиться в точности сведений. Криптографические способы гарантируют постоянство данных после присоединения в цепочку. Децентрализованное размещение гарантирует значительную доступность данных при отказе доли серверов в pokerdom.
Масштабируемость остаётся значительным ограничением технологии. Пропускная способность большинства сетей существенно проигрывает централизованным системам. Каждый узел выполняет все транзакции, что порождает дублирование и тормозит работу при увеличении нагрузки.
Энергопотребление протоколов согласия требует немалых средств. Расчётные подходы расходуют электричество на решение вычислительных проблем. Размер сведений постоянно увеличивается, формируя проблемы для хранения полной летописи. Необратимость транзакций исключает возможность аннулирования неверных операций, что предполагает повышенной внимательности от пользователей.
Примеры использования блокчейна
Технология покердом получает применение в различных секторах хозяйства и публичного администрирования. Криптовалюты стали начальным широким использованием децентрализованных журналов для трансфера ценности без intermediaries. Финансовые учреждения реализуют технологии для убыстрения международных транзакций и уменьшения расходов.
Главные направления использования технологии охватывают:
- Управление последовательностями поставок позволяет прослеживать перемещение товаров от изготовителя до потребителя с фиксацией каждого этапа
- Платформы цифрового голосования обеспечивают открытость суммирования голосов и исключают искажение итогов
- Журналы недвижимости регистрируют права собственности и хронологию сделок с объектами в постоянном виде
- Медицинские карты пациентов хранятся в защищённом формате с контролируемым доступом для докторов
Смарт-контракты автоматизируют выполнение договорённостей без вовлечения третьих участников. Программный код выполняет условия договора при возникновении предварительно определённых событий в покердом казино. Страховые компании применяют автоматические компенсации при удостоверении страховых случаев. Авторские права защищаются через регистрацию электронного контента с временными отметками формирования.
